Illinois has advanced to the 12th position in a respected business state ranking, moving up from 30th since J.B. Pritzker assumed office. The announcement comes as Pritzker credits ongoing efforts to make Illinois an attractive location for businesses and workers. The improvement, as cited in a recent tweet, reflects progress in the state’s business climate and competitive standing within the U.S. Pritzker said the work will continue to reinforce Illinois as a favorable environment for economic growth.
